The WRM60 X PRO Series from Western CO includes advanced 60A MPPT charge controllers designed for professional off-grid and hybrid solar systems operating at 24V or 48V. Featuring 2 independent MPPT inputs, WBUS communication, and compatibility with both CAN BUS lithium batteries and standard Pb/Li battery banks, this system delivers intelligent, scalable energy management.
The WRM60 X M (Master) model operates independently and supports full monitoring via the my Leonardo App and web platform. For larger systems, it can be paired with the WRM60 X SL (Slave) version to extend power up to 50kW, offering a modular and expandable charging solution.

🔹 WRM60 X M (Master) – Main Controller
- 60A MPPT charging current
- 2 independent PV inputs (MPPT)
- 24V / 48V auto-detection
- Compatible with Smart Lithium (CAN BUS) & Pb/Li batteries
- WBUS communication system
- Data monitoring via my Leonardo App (Android/iOS) + cloud portal
- Advanced display (128x64) with logger and control keys
- Smart load activation based on battery status
🔹 WRM60 X SL (Slave) – Power Extender
- Works in tandem with WRM60 X Master
- Adds up to 50kW charging capability to the system
- 2 MPPT channels, 60A charging current
- Designed for scalable, high-power PV systems
